The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Mar. 30, 2021
Filed:
Jan. 22, 2019
Johnson Controls Technology Company, Auburn Hills, MI (US);
Gregory B. Cebasek, New Berlin, WI (US);
Joshua A. Edler, Milwaukee, WI (US);
Peter J. Hazelberg, Dousman, WI (US);
Kunal Saini, Milwaukee, WI (US);
Jonathan M. Schwabe, Muskego, WI (US);
Matthew T. Trawicki, Franklin, WI (US);
Michael G. Welch, Milwaukee, WI (US);
Johnson Controls Technology Company, Auburn Hills, MI (US);
Abstract
A building automation system (BAS) with microservice architecture. The system includes a server platform configured to perform various operations within the building automation system. The server platform includes a microservices platform configured to execute various processes within the BAS. The microservices platform includes a plurality of nodes where each node is configured to run one or more services as separate processes. The microservices platform further includes a message bus configured to control communication between processes and an orchestration network configured to control communication between the plurality of nodes. The server platform further includes a common data model (CDM) shared between the plurality of nodes where the CDM consists of metadata of the BAS. The server platform further includes a container orchestration platform configured to manage and control the plurality of nodes.